The Art and Science of Natural Dyeing: A Global Guide to Sustainable Fabric Care

In an era of fast fashion and synthetic dyes, the allure of natural dyeing and sustainable fabric care has re-emerged. From the ancient traditions of indigo dyeing in Japan and West Africa to the vibrant hues of madder root in Europe and Asia, natural dyes offer a connection to the earth and a more environmentally conscious approach to textiles. This guide explores the world of natural dyes, delving into the science behind creating lasting colors and providing practical tips for caring for your naturally dyed fabrics.

Mordants: The Key to Colorfastness

A mordant is a substance that helps the dye bind to the fabric fibers. Without a mordant, the color may fade or wash out easily. Common mordants include:

Important Note: Always use mordants with care and follow safety precautions. Wear gloves and eye protection when handling mordants. Research the specific properties and potential risks of each mordant before use.
